Publisher Description: THE NOVEL THAT LAUNCHED ONE OF THE GREATEST MOUNTAIN MAN SERIES The American West. A land wild and free and dangerous. Only a brave man dared accept the challenge of a harsh and unforgiving frontier. Gordon Hawkes was such a man. A man of courage. A man of strong will. A mountain man. This is his story. The promise of a new life draws Hawkes and his parents away from Ireland to seek a new beginning. But the sea claims his folks and leaves him alone to stake his claim. Befriended by a Scots adventurer, Hawkes heads west. But trouble has a way of finding him. Accused of murder in New Orleans and chased by bounty hunters in St. Louis, he is confronted with one harsh test of survival after another. In spite of the obstacles, he finds his true calling in the untamed western mountains. And it is here that his greatest adventure of all begins.
